Niagara County Community College knocked off two nationally-ranked opponents at this past weekend's annual T-Wolves Holiday Classic. The Thunderwolves, ranked No. 4 in the last NJCAA Div. II poll, improved to 11-0 overall. NCCC returns to action at 7:30 p.m. Wednesday when it travels to local conference rival Erie Community College.
No. 4 Niagara CCC 62, No. 9 Macomb CC 54
NCCC sophomore Aaron Miller had his best outing of the season with 21 points and 10 rebounds in the win. Also for N-Trip, freshman Oumaru Hydara had 13 points, sophomore LaMarqus Merchant Jr. scored 11 points and classmate Lamar Lovelace chipped in with 10 points in the win.
No. 4 Niagara CCC 96, No. 12 Lakeland CC 81
Hydara came off the bench to contribute 18 points, five assists and four steals in the victory. Miller and Lovelace each netted 15 points, while Merchant had 13 points and five assists and sophomore Taylor Sanders added 12 points. The T-Wolves out-scored the visiting Lakers 59-39 after intermission.
